Photos / Sounds

What

Butterflies and Moths (Order Lepidoptera)

Observer

spiralis123

Date

January 28, 2016

Description

Larvae of the Agrotis moth, found in marram grass at Allan's Beach, Otago Peninsula.

Photos / Sounds

Observer

spiralis123

Date

May 8, 2016

Description

Oxydromus species of polychaete worm (bristle worm). Found in significiant numbers washed up on Allan's Beach, Otago Peninsula. Recent reports that these have been found along the eastern Otago coast.

Photos / Sounds

What

Waratah Anemone (Actinia tenebrosa)

Observer

spiralis123

Date

May 23, 2015 04:02 PM NZST

Description

This beautiful anemone grows along the sea walls of the lower Peninsula Road in the Otago Harbour. I took this photograph while investigating the effects of reclamation from the planned road widening on the intertidal area.
